WA5CAB at cs.com wrote:
> Incidentally, you left out TS 24 and a couple of other garbles I've seen.
> Unfortunately, since they "improved" the search engine on e--y, it ignores
> hyphens, etc. I have a bunch of RC-292 antenna sets and was wanting to see whether
> any were being flogged there (at the time, there were). But because the
> search engine now ignors the hyphen, I got all sorts of worthless hits like RC
> #292. But most search engines are strictly literal.
>
> I've seen somewhere in official documents SCR-274-N rendered as SCR-274N and
> the indication that N originally stood for "Navy", not the Nth model or
> revision or reorder. But from what I turned up here this morning, it appears that
> by 1944 at least, the "error" had been corrected. :-)
